Output 42bdc321f0577b4c9720343887e613166b0a392da2b2022d0aba51d389cdb159:113

value
19798217
script pubkey
OP_0 OP_PUSHBYTES_20 beb01ef13bd790e312e9a437e70aba9be5c4a682
address
bc1qh6cpaufm67gwxyhf5sm7wz46n0juff5znh3qlh
transaction
42bdc321f0577b4c9720343887e613166b0a392da2b2022d0aba51d389cdb159